@@ -92,6 +92,8 @@ There are eight main network technology issues that must be addressed at each la
in the architecture though. These are outlined below:
+
+
1. Mechanism of identifying senders and receivers: addressing.
2. Rules for data transfer: simplex, half-duplex, or full-duplex.
3. Logical channels: sharing a link among a number of connections.
@@ -100,6 +102,8 @@ in the architecture though. These are outlined below:
6. Incompatible speed between fast sender and slow receiver.
7. Message fragmentation and assembly.
8. Strategies for choosing routes.
